Quote:
Originally Posted by hratchian View Post
I am not snapping at any one

Ah as for paypal closed the case " The claim was incomplete, filed incorrectly, or outside the bounds of coverage as defined in our User Agreement."
If you included in your claim that you were supposed to receive a live animal then yes, PP would deny it since there is no buyer protection for animals.

If you stated that you sent payment and the seller never shipped then that is covered. So, how did you word your claim?

Also, you have not even answered basic questions like when you sent the payment(s).
